The climate below pushes materials to their restrictions. Copper expands and contracts with big temperature level swings, lug links loosen up slightly year over year, and UV exposure eats away at wire insulation on exterior runs that were not shielded appropriately. In older homes, a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and very early 1970s can complicate issues. These systems can be ensured with the best connectors and approaches, but only if a pro comprehends the equipment, the history, and our regional code amendments.
Monsoon period includes one more layer. A quick electrical storm can produce voltage spikes. Without proper rise defense at the service and point-of-use security at sensitive gadgets, you take the chance of silent damages to devices. I have seen brand-new heat pumps degrade in a solitary season due to the fact that surge risk was ignored. The solution costs much much Lighting design and installation less than a compressor replacement.
Finally, Phoenix az's quick development implies lots of homes got piecemeal enhancements. Removed garages wired by a useful uncle in 1998, patio electrical out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V chargers added to panels that had no capacity to save. None of these issues are uncommon. They just need an organized approach.

New electrical wiring is just just as good as the style behind it. When we discuss wiring installation Phoenix residents often suggest one of 3 points: complete or partial rewires in older homes, dedicated circuits for big loads, or low-voltage and smart-home facilities to sustain networking and security.
Rewires require perseverance and planning. In 1950s brick homes around Arcadia, fishing new NM-B through stucco and plaster without scarring ended up wall surfaces requires mindful mapping, little medical cuts, and coordinating with a patch-and-paint team. In wood-frame houses, attic room job during summer season needs organizing at dawn to keep professionals secure and concentrated, and to prevent hurried mistakes in 120-degree areas. An excellent electrical company Phoenix home owners work with will certainly establish expectations on timeline, dust control, and everyday cleanup, after that hit those marks.
Dedicated circuits repay right away. Microwaves, dishwashing machines, and particularly EV chargers act better and last much longer when they are not showing to lights or small appliance circuits. The exact same opts for garage door openers and freezers. The cost to add a brand-new 20-amp circuit and a quality receptacle pales next to the expense of ruined food or electric motor damages after repeated undervoltage events. If your panel is marginal, a subpanel can be a tidy option that adds adaptability without a solution upgrade.
Low-voltage lines matter greater than many people realize. If you are restoring, take the possibility to run Category 6 cable for trustworthy internet, coax for antenna or cord, and 18/2 or 18/4 for sensors and landscape illumination. Wireless devices are convenient, however a hardwired backbone gives you speed and security during tornados or when Wi-Fi missteps. Bundle runs nicely, tag both ends, and keep line-voltage and low-voltage in separate bays to prevent interference. Repairs frequently begin with signs and symptoms that look minor.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ys every now and then, an electrical outlet that really feels cozy. In Phoenix metro we see a pattern of issues tied to heat biking and aging components.
Loose neutral connections show up as dimming lights when an electric motor starts, or arbitrary fl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en in time, and the very same occurs at device backstabs that were never ever tightened up appropriately. Backstabs save a min throughout initial mount however age improperly. We move links to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and test under load.
Breaker exhaustion is actual. Thermal-magnetic breakers take care of thousands of tiny warmth cycles. In a panel that beings in a hot garage, those cycles increase. If a breaker trips at moderate tons, it may be weary instead of overloaded. Substitute is straightforward, though we validate the circuit's real draw with a clamp meter prior to exchanging parts.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) trips intermittently, it may be reacting to a legitimate arc mistake from a nicked conductor or an inexpensive plug strip. We chase the mistake rather than covering up it.
Exterior receptacles and illumination boxes often lose their weather condition seals. UV turns gaskets fragile, then the very first monsoon drives dampness inside. GFCIs should journey, and if they do not, that is a bigger problem. A fast contact a high quality tester, brand-new in-use covers, and proper caulking against stucco quit most water invasion issues. When deterioration has held, we replace the gadget and cord nuts, and if required, the box.
Attic splices from old satellite installs or DIY fans are another Phoenix metro unique. Loosened wirenuts buried in blown-in insulation are a fire risk. An extensive repair service includes locating joint factors, installing accepted junction boxes with covers, strain soothing the conductors, and recording locations for future inspection.
A good strategy aligns with your way of living and the city's power account. Energy rates, discount chances, and grid anxiety shape what makes sense. As more residents include EVs and heat pumps, lots administration comes to be critical. You can prevent a full service upgrade if you present large loads with a wise panel or a straightforward load-shedding tool. As an example, you can mount a 50-amp EV battery charger that stops when the electrical oven and clothes dryer fused, then returns to billing overnight. It is invisible being used and can conserve thousands on a utility-side service upgrade.
Surge defense is no more optional. Whole-home devices at the primary panel guard costly electronics and HVAC boards. Look for tools with a clear condition indicator and a joule ranking that matches your service. Pair that with point-of-use strips for computers and enjoyment facilities. After any type of considerable surge, inspect the condition lights. I suggest clients to photograph the panel tool's indicator when it is new, after that contrast after huge storms.
Grounding and bonding should have a fresh look on homes constructed prior to the 1990s. Gradually, ground rods rust, clamps loosen up, and extra bonds to copper water piping are shed throughout pipes job. A fast audit verifies connection and maintains mistake currents on the course they belong. This is just one of those jobs that stops problems you never ever see.
Lighting is a very easy win. High-CRI LED components boost comfort, lower heat load, and reduced costs. In kitchens, pair warm job illumination with cooler ambient trims to maintain shades true on food and surface areas. Outdoors, calm the bright-hot Phoenix az night with protected, color-appropriate components that satisfy dark-sky perceptiveness and avoid frustrating neighbors.

Service upgrades require thoughtful validation. Not every home requires to leap from 100 amps to 200. A tons calculation tells the truth. For several Phoenix az homes, a 125-amp or 150-amp service fulfills requirements when paired with smart tons management. On the various other hand, if you prepare a swimming pool heatpump, 2 EVs, and a workshop with a 5-hp dirt collection agency, prepare for 200 amps and area for future breakers. Coordinate with the utility for meter pulls and timetable around examination home windows. In summer, teams often present the upgrade early in the early morning to restrict time without AC.
Code is not a checklist of hoops to jump via. It is the advancing memory of mistakes the trade has discovered not to repeat. Arizona follows the National Electrical Code with local changes. In Phoenix metro, inspectors watch closely electrical services Phoenix for arc-fault protection in habitable rooms,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and correct assistance and protection of NM cord. Installations that function fine on day one can still fall short inspection if a staple is missing out on or a box fill mores than capacity. A top-rated electrical expert understands where these information live and obtains them right the initial time.
Aluminum electrical wiring, common in certain periods, can be risk-free if repaired and preserved with the right connectors and antioxidant compound. The key is to prevent mixed-metal terminations not rated for it. I have actually seen scorched tools where a well-meaning proprietor switched a receptacle without recognizing the conductor was aluminum. If your home has aluminum branch circuits, go over COPALUM or AlumiConn repair work with your electrical contractor. Both have track records when set up correctly.

EV chargers are one of one of the most requested enhancements currently.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it prevails, yet not always essential. Several proprietors bill overnight on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a full battery. Smart battery chargers can throttle draw to match readily available capability, which typically prevents a panel upgrade. An experienced electrician Phoenix homeowners hire will certainly review your panel, your everyday driving, and your home's lots profile before recommending a size.
Solar complicates the panel picture. Backfeed guidelines limit just how much solar you can link right into a provided bus. Sometimes a line-side tap or a panel with higher bus ranking solves the math. Occasionally a brand-new main breaker with decreased amperage on a panel that still supports your actual lots opens up area for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ive decisions, the sort you desire a seasoned electrician and solar designer to handle together.
Battery storage space adds weight to the wall surface, new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ations demands. Your electrical expert must plan clear labeling, emergency shutoffs, and a format that service techs can browse without guesswork. In a warm Phoenix metro garage, sufficient spacing and air flow for devices are crucial.

Electricians in Phoenix typically charge between $75 and $130 per hour for standard residential work. Service calls often include a minimum fee ranging from $100 to $200. Complex jobs, emergency work, or panel upgrades can increase the total cost. Prices vary based on experience, licensing, and job scope.
Electricians in Phoenix earn an average annual salary between $55,000 and $70,000. Entry-level electricians earn less, while licensed journeymen and master electricians earn more. Overtime and specialized skills can significantly increase earnings. Union membership may also affect pay.
The average hourly wage for an electrician in Arizona ranges from $25 to $40 per hour. Apprentices typically earn less, while master electricians earn at the higher end. Rates depend on certification level, experience, and region. Metro areas generally pay more than rural areas.
Yes, electricians are in strong demand in Arizona. Population growth, construction activity, and infrastructure upgrades drive consistent need. Renewable energy projects and commercial development further increase demand. Job growth projections remain above average for the trade.
Electricity costs in Phoenix are slightly below the national average per kilowatt-hour. However, total bills can be high due to heavy air conditioning use. Summer energy consumption significantly increases monthly costs. Energy efficiency plays a major role in controlling expenses.
Electrician rates typically range from $75 to $130 per hour for residential work. Commercial and industrial rates are often higher. Flat-rate pricing may be used for common jobs like outlet replacement or fixture installation. Rates reflect labor, overhead, and licensing requirements.
States such as Illinois, New York, and California generally pay electricians the highest wages. Average hourly rates in these states often exceed $45 per hour. Higher pay is linked to union presence, cost of living, and demand. Metro areas within these states pay the most.
Residential electricians in Arizona earn approximately $50,000 to $65,000 per year. Income varies by experience level and certification. Self-employed electricians may earn more depending on workload. Overtime and specialty skills can raise annual earnings.
Natural gas is generally cheaper than electricity in Arizona for heating and appliances. Electric costs increase significantly during summer months due to cooling demand. Gas prices tend to be more stable year-round. Cost differences depend on usage patterns and appliance efficiency.
$30 per hour is considered a solid wage in Phoenix. It is above the city’s median hourly wage and supports a moderate cost of living. This rate is common for skilled trades and experienced technicians. Actual purchasing power depends on housing and household size.
Becoming a licensed electrician in Arizona typically takes 4 to 5 years. This includes classroom instruction and on-the-job apprenticeship hours. Licensing requires passing exams and meeting experience requirements. Timelines vary by specialization and training path.
$20 per hour is slightly above Arizona’s average hourly wage. It is suitable for entry-level skilled work or early-career roles. Living comfortably may require budgeting in higher-cost areas. Benefits and overtime can improve overall compensation.
